What is the most significant type of crime affecting Melton?

Quick Answer

Based on available data, Melton exhibits a comparatively low crime rate of 52.4 per 1,000 residents, significantly below the UK average of 91.6. While specific crime types aren’t detailed, Melton boasts a high safety score of 86/100.

Melton, a BUA with a population of 1773, exhibits a crime rate of 52.4 incidents per 1,000 residents. This is considerably lower than the UK average, which stands at 91.6 incidents per 1,000. This lower crime rate contributes to Melton’s impressive safety score of 86 out of 100, significantly higher than the UK average of 79.
